The canton of Hauteville-Lompnes is an administrative division in eastern France. Its communes are:
| Commune | Inhabitants | Postal code |
Insee code |
|---|---|---|---|
| Aranc | 275 | 01110 | 01012 |
| Corlier | 73 | 01110 | 01121 |
| Cormaranche-en-Bugey | 726 | 01110 | 01122 |
| Hauteville-Lompnes | 3 662 | 01110 | 01185 |
| Prémillieu | 33 | 01510 | 01311 |
| Thézillieu | 299 | 01110 | 01417 |
